Howell Appears On CACC Men’s Lacrosse Weekly Honor Roll
 
New Haven, Conn. – (3/22/2021) – Junior attack J.R. Howell (East Meadow, N.Y.) led the Scarlet and Gold with five points (3 goals, 2 assists), ground ball, and a caused turnover in Saturday’s narrow 10-8 loss to #19 Frostburg State University. Howell led the Scarlet and Gold with five points (3 goals, 2 assists), a ground ball, and a caused turnover; his performance earned him recognition on this week’s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) Men’s Lacrosse Honor Roll.
 
The final 15 minutes was all that mattered as Chestnut Hill College (2-2) and #19 Frostburg State University (3-0) entered the fourth quarter of play tied at 6-6. In the fourth quarter, Howell took advantage on a man-up opportunity, 7-6 (13:15), before making Scarlet and Gold history with his 82nd career assist finding Revak to tie the contest at 8-8 with 5:04 (Revak) remaining in the contest. Unfortunately, the Scarlet and Gold celebration was short-lived as the Bobcats outran the Griffins to a 10-8 conclusion.
 
The Griffins came out strong with a man-up connection between senior attack Scott Wilden (Wexford, Pa.) and Howell (1-0, 10:33), and a pair of goals from senior midfielder Ben Revak (Aston, Pa.) (9:34, 5:39) puting the Griffins up 3-0. The Bobcats managed to trim the Scarlet and Gold lead to 3-1 by the end of the opening frame, but senior attack Carson Rees (Port Coquitlam, B.C.) found freshman attack Jackson Melnick (Milford, Pa.) (4-1, 14:41) and Howell connected with junior midfielder Jack Clyne (Islip Terrace, N.Y.) (5-1, 10:33) to put the Griffins up 5-1 with 10:33 remaining in the second quarter. Unfortunately, late Bobcat tallies reduced the halftime spread to 5-3; a measure that was further cut to zero by a 3-1 third-quarter swing, 6-6.
 
Chestnut Hill College returns to Victory Field #1 next Saturday, March 27, when they host Roberts Wesleyan College in a 11:00 a.m. contest.
